Holy Cow BBQ on Pico is Making a Comeback

The BBQ chain temporarily closed its westside outpost for remodeling, but a planning permit shows that the store will soon reopen

Holy Cow — a BBQ chain helmed by Rob Serritella — will soon reopen after closing for remodeling, according to a planning permit.

The outpost, located at 10645 W Pico Blvd, Los Angeles, CA 90064, is one of four locations, with the three others hailing from Redondo Beach, Culver City, and Santa Monica.

Holy Cow BBQ offers an array of simple, high-quality eats including Carolina pulled pork, a Big BBQ sampler, a brisket sando, wings, salads, and, of course, delicious sides like mac & cheese and a baked sweet potato.
